Two years after his previous work "Serious Shit," Yuhei Yamada has released a new video! It's called "Komainu"

 

Yuhei Yamada (aka Kun-san), based in Sapporo, continues his filming activities while traveling to various locations such as Nagano Prefecture and Colorado in the United States.
Two years after his previous work, "Serious Shit," his long-awaited full street part is finally released. It's called "Komainu"

Anyone who's been captivated by action sports, whether it's freestyle skiing, snowboarding, skateboarding, or BMX, has probably fantasized about things like, "If only I could jump over that..." or "If only I could scrape against that railing at the station or school..."
Yuhei Yamada is that boy who grew up into an adult, and "Komainu" is a film that visualizes his imagination.

He is a freestyle ski enthusiast and an experienced park digger. Utilizing the equipment construction techniques he has honed at famous snow parks in Japan, he transforms urban areas into snow parks. For Yamada, who has skied at authentic American parks, it was inevitable that he would move to the streets to further test his passion and skills

The film, which was shot over a two-year period, is packed with shots of such high quality that it's hard to believe they're individual parts. The footage makes you realize how freely two skis can be used, and how they can become a tool that can be enjoyed anywhere. In addition to the full four-minute part, a rough cut without background music is also scheduled to be released, in order to make the most of the real sounds from the location

[Profile]

Yuhei Yamada
is from Hokkaido. He is a multi-talented skier who balances work as a photographer and rider. He is also a freestyle skiing enthusiast and checks out every video release from various production companies every year.
